AFBytes Brief

The Russian president noted ongoing coordination with Belarus to address shared external challenges. Remarks were delivered in the context of Belarus Independence Day. The comments underscore the depth of bilateral ties.

Why this matters

Closer Russia-Belarus military and political alignment can affect NATO planning and European energy security that indirectly touches U.S. alliance commitments.
